Description
This paper investigates a variant of cellular automata, namely ν-CA. Indeed, ν-CA are cellular automata which can have dierent local rules at each site of their lattice. The assignment of local rules to sites of the lattice completely characterizes ν-CA. In this paper, sets of assignments sharing some interesting properties are associated with languages of bi-innite words. The complexity classes of these languages are investigated providing an initial rough classica-tion of ν-CA.
